Default Excel Object in VB when running under scheduler control

Hello;

I've done a VB program that opens an Excel Sheet Object
and writes some data into it from Access. It works fine
when I activate the .cmd file that starts the program, but
if I automate it by means of the build-in MS scheduler, it
gets an error when the program does "Set objexcel =
CreateObject("Excel.Sheet")". I should add that I only get
this error when running on a server. The program can run
under scheduler control on my own labtop without problems.
I use the same user ID on the server and in the Scheduled
Task (Run as: <user ID.)

Thank you for any help.
